What affects the price

Plumbing costs change based on the specific issues you're facing. The total depends on the age of your pipes, the accessibility of the leak or clog, and the materials needed for the repair. Complex jobs involving wall access or replacing older fixtures will naturally require more time and labor than a standard drain clearing. What should I do before calling a plumber in Spokane?

Before calling, try to identify the source of the problem if possible, and turn off the water supply to the affected area to prevent further damage. Note down any symptoms like strange noises or smells. This information will help the licensed pros in Spokane understand the issue more quickly when they arrive.
